How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    SEN Learning Support Assistant - Oxford

    Are you a Psychology graduate eager to gain practical experience supporting young people with special educational needs?

    A Secondary SEN School in Oxford is seeking a dedicated, patient, and compassionate SEN Learning Support Assistant to join their team. This role is ideal for aspiring Educational Psychologists, Clinical Psychologists, Speech and Language Therapists, Occupational Therapists, Teachers.

    As a SEN Learning Support Assistant, you will:

    Provide 1:1 and small group support to students with a range of special educational needs.
    Support students with their learning, communication, social development, and independence.
    Adapt support to meet individual students' needs and learning styles.
    Encourage students to participate positively in lessons and school activities.
    Build positive, trusting relationships with students and provide consistent encouragement.We're looking for a SEN Learning Support Assistant who is:

    Compassionate, patient, and enthusiastic about supporting young people.
    A confident communicator with a genuine passion for special educational needs.
    Adaptable and able to respond positively to different students' individual needs.
    Interested in gaining practical experience before pursuing a career in psychology, education, therapy, or specialist SEN support.Job Details

    Location: Oxford
    Setting: SEN School
    Start Date: ASAP
    Pay: £93-£110 per day
    Hours: Monday to Friday, 8:30am-3:30pm
    Contract: Full-timeApply today and take the next step towards a rewarding career in SEN, psychology, therapy, or education, while making a meaningful difference to young people's lives.
